Proposal
Listed Building Consent for the repainting of an external door, the installation of 2no. vents on the west elevation, and internal alterations comprising the infilling of a doorway and formation of a new doorway, the construction of a new timber stud partition, new lighting and sanitaryware, the replacement of skirting and architraves, and the repainting of windows.
As published by the council, reference 25/00988/LBC

About heritage and listed building applications
Listed building consent is needed for works that affect the special interest of a listed building, and carrying out such works without it is a criminal offence. More in our guide to planning application types.
